Word of the Day is a reminder of ‘snerdling’: 19th-century dialect for snuggling beneath the covers for as long as possible.

Whatever It Takes by Joy Wood, released in July 2024, is a riveting mystery thriller that has captivated readers and critics alike, earning the prestigious RNA (Romantic Novelists’ Association) Award in the Romantic Thriller category. Set in a tranquil Nottingham cul-de-sac, the novel follows Lorna and Dan Lloyd, a couple living in their dream home. Lorna, a socialite craving excitement, feels unfulfilled, while Dan, a successful accountant and fitness enthusiast, remains devoted but unaware of her restlessness. Their lives take a dramatic turn when charismatic new neighbors, Perry and Ingrid Hunter, move in. The couple’s fast friendship—marked by intimate dinners, trips, and a fateful Greek holiday—leads to a fatal accident that binds the survivors to a dark secret. Someone is determined to keep it hidden, no matter the cost. Readers have raved about the novel’s suspense and unpredictable twists.
